I'm installing a magnum intake on my non magnum Neon. I've noticed that the magnum engines have a very large insulated PCV hose. Does anybody know why its insulated? Can I just use some regular hose?

I've wondered that too. Mystery to me though, doesn't seem to be a point to it. I'm using 3/8" fuel line from the VC down to my magnum mani, but 3/8" won't go over the barb on the manifold, so I used a short section of 1/2" heater hose as a coupler. You'll only need 2 inches of the 1/2". The 3/8" hose goes into 1/2" hose about an inch, and then the other inch of 1/2" slides onto the barb. I used a hose clamp to keep that short piece of heater hose on the 3/8" fuel line. Works great, 'cept I've got to change it a bit when I install my catch can that sitting at home right now.
